Biology Fortified proposes a wiki for GMOs

The following is an excerpt.

Today there may be the kind of critical mass necessary to move [a GMO wiki project] forward and make it really useful for everyone. And we can pay the costs of securing a domain name and creating some graphics to make it look unique. Who wants in?

There are many reasons to build a wiki for information about GMOs, but it will be good to define what the main purposes of the site will be. The two goals that I think rise to the top are to provide easily understood and well-referenced background information for people who are seeking information about GMOs. The second is to provide careful and thorough rebuttals and/or confirmations of the claims that people make about them.
